Personal Data & Key Details

Full NameKaren Vieth Edgar (later Karen Vieth Knight)
Known ForSecond wife of legendary basketball coach Bob Knight
ProfessionFormer High School Basketball Coach (at Lomega High School, Oklahoma); Former Bloomington High School North teacher and administrator
SpouseBob Knight (married 1988, until his passing in 2023)
Marriage DateMay 23, 1988
Ages at MarriageBob Knight: 47, Karen Vieth Edgar: 41
Estimated Net Worth$500 thousand
ChildrenStepmother to Tim and Pat Knight (Bob Knight's children from his first marriage)
Status (as of 2023)Mourning her husband's death in 2023

The Love Story: Karen Vieth Edgar and Bob Knight's Enduring Partnership

The story of Bob Knight and Karen Vieth Edgar's marriage began after a significant chapter in Knight's life had closed. Bob Knight had previously been married to Nancy Falk, with whom he shared two children, Tim and Pat. His divorce from Falk occurred in 1985. Soon after, a new chapter unfolded, leading him to Karen Vieth Edgar. Their relationship blossomed, and they were dating for about a year after getting together in 1987 before tying the knot. This period allowed them to build a foundation, leading to a profound connection that would last for decades. Their union in 1988 marked the beginning of what is described as a "beautiful and enduring relationship" that continued until Knight's passing. This partnership was more than just a legal bond; it was a testament to finding love and companionship later in life, built on mutual understanding and shared experiences.

The Wedding Day: A New Chapter Begins

On May 23, 1988, Bob Knight and Karen Vieth Edgar exchanged wedding vows at the Indiana Interchurch Center in Indianapolis. At the time of their marriage, Knight was 47 years old, and Edgar was 41. This age difference of six years was relatively modest, and their maturity likely contributed to the stability of their union. They had filed for a marriage license in Monroe County, solidifying their commitment. Mourning a Legend: Karen Vieth Edgar in 2023

The enduring partnership between Karen Vieth Edgar and Bob Knight came to a close with his passing on November 1, 2023. At the time of his death, Bob Knight was survived by his wife, Karen Vieth Edgar, and his two sons, Tim and Pat.
